Now playing Next Euronews Witness Could the ‘dump of death’ near Mostar be making locals ill? A landfill near Mostar in Bosnia and Herzegovina is leaking black fluid containing copper, lead, zinc, and arsenic at worrying levels according to test results taken by locals who are worried the dumpsite is attributed to deaths from cancer. 26/11/2021
